A documentary is a film or television program that presents real facts about people, events, or nature, often using interviews and real footage.

Usually refers to non-fiction video or film. Typical collocations: "watch a documentary," "nature documentary," "historical documentary." Not used for fiction or news programs. More formal than calling something just a "movie."
